// This example plots a rotated Sprite to the screen using the pushRotated() // function. It is written for a 240 x 320 TFT screen. // Two rotation pivot points must be set, one for the Sprite and one for the TFT // using setPivot(). These pivot points do not need to be within the visible screen // or Sprite boundary. // When the Sprite is rotated and pushed to the TFT with pushRotated(angle) it will be // drawn so that the two pivot points coincide. This makes rotation about a point on the // screen very simple. The rotation is clockwise with increasing angle. The angle is in // degrees, an angle of 0 means no Sprite rotation. // The pushRotated() function works with 1, 4, 8 and 16 bit per pixel (bpp) Sprites. // The original Sprite is unchanged so can be plotted again at a different angle. // Optionally a transparent colour can be defined, pixels of this colour will // not be plotted to the TFT. // For 1 bpp Sprites the foreground and background colours are defined with the // function spr.setBitmapColor(foregroundColor, backgroundColor). // For 4 bpp Sprites the colour map index is used instead of the 16 bit colour // e.g. spr.setTextColor(5);
